      Lucio Phenomenon: Sequelae of Neglected Leprosy

      research Lucio Phenomenon: Sequelae of Neglected Leprosy

      14 citations , January 2020 in “Korean Journal of Family Medicine”
      This case study reported a rare occurrence of lepromatous leprosy with Lucio phenomenon in a 50-year-old Indonesian living in Malaysia, highlighting the necessity for primary care practitioners, even in non-endemic areas, to recognize this serious leprosy reaction to prevent complications and transmission.
